Summary

Hundreds of full-color photos, charts, and diagrams accompany start-to-finish lessons on quilting styles – hand, machine, trapunto, appliqué – plus a wealth of patterns and sewing tips. Suitable for beginners to experts.

Marianne Fons and Liz Porter met in a beginners' quilting class in Winterset, Iowa, in 1976. After the class, they started a quilters' club, and as they learned skills together, people asked them to provide workshops on how to quilt. They've always worked together to teach their classes to boost their confidence, especially early on when they were just learning themselves.

Together, they've written more than two dozen books over the years, and Quilter's Complete Guide is one of their most successful. They continue to write and teach, traveling the world to workshops and quilting symposiums.
